TTArtisan’s Ultra-Affordable Full-Frame 85mm f/1.8 Lens Costs Just $99

TTArtisan has announced the AF 85mm f/1.8 Neo, a new extremely affordable full-frame portrait prime lens for Sony and Nikon mirrorless cameras. The 85mm f/1.8 prime costs just $99.
The Chinese lens maker is positioning its new, aggressively priced prime lens as prioritizing image quality and little else. “Pure image. Nothing extra,” TTArtisan says.

German neo-Nazi suspected of deadly 1970 fire at Jewish retirement home
German investigators believe they have now identified an arsonist who set fire to a Jewish community centre in Munich in 1970, killing seven people.
For decades the man's identity remained a mystery. But Munich prosecutors now believe he was a 25-year-old lone neo-Nazi with known antisemitic opinions.
The seven killed were all Holocaust survivors aged 59 to 71. Another 15 people were injured.
